Congrats on the 705,and welcome from Pennsylvania..that’s one great machine..One thing I’d like to mention,and this is just my experience.When you use ID normalization a + symbol will be at the top of the screen when activated..it always seemed to make me good signals sound choppy, and the visual ID numbers wrong.
